What is the Student Ambassador Program?

Student Ambassadors are a select group of students who play a critical role as liaisons between the students, staff, faculty, and the greater San Diego community. 

They represent the current student body to alumni and prospective students. The Student Ambassadors are an essential component of our mission to be an innovative, student-centered organization.

Student Ambassador Responsibilities

Role #1

Serve as a liaison between current students, staff, and faculty members.

Role #2

Assist in student activities to make positive experiences at ICOHS College.

Role #3

Assist in coordination and coverage of various events at ICOHS College.

Role #4

Complete 1 Passion Project* that will help and give back to the community.

*A Student Ambassador will manage a project of their choice in relation to their respective program. Must be approved by the Student Services Coordinator.
